When you subtract one negative integer from another will your answer be greater than or less than the integer you started with
MatroZZZ [7]

Subtracting a negative integer is the same as adding a positive integer. Adding a positive integer to any number always makes the answer larger than the original number. Therefore, if you subtract one negative integer from another your answer will be always be *greater* than the integer you started with.
